Errol's bike ride from home to school can be modeled by the equation d(t) = -4t+2, where d(t) is
8_murik_8 [283]

Answer:

Option (2).It has a vertical translation by 2 units in the positive direction.

Step-by-step explanation:

Given question is not complete: find the  complete question with attachment

Errol's bike ride can be modeled by the equation,

d(t)=-\frac{1}{4}t+2

Slope of the given equation = -\frac{1}{4} which shows the rate of change of distance from Errol's house

Y-intercept = 2, shows the distance of the school from Errol's house

Let the equation that represents the distance of Daniel's home from the school is,

y = mt + b

Since speed of Daniel is equal to the speed of Errol, slopes of both the equations will be same.

Since y-intercept 'b' represents the distance from his home, b = 4

Now the equation will be,

d(t)=-\frac{1}{4}t+4

Therefore, the graph representing the Daniel's equation will have a vertical translation by 2 units in the positive direction.
